A voluntary isolation on a remote island will become the gateway to an enigma that defies the rules of logic and memory. The anime film based on the work Doko Yori mo Tooi Basho ni Iru Kimi e (To You in the Beyond) presented its first official trailer accompanied by a new promotional image, confirming that this title will join the Japanese box office on October 9th.

The team behind the film adaptation

The cinematic adaptation rests on the shoulders of the prestigious TMS Entertainment studio, with Junichi Wada in the director's chair. The narrative structure has been adapted into a screenplay by Sayaka Kuwamura, while the visual aesthetic of the Japanese animation is the responsibility of Hechima, who serves simultaneously as character designer and chief animation director. Distribution in Japanese theaters will be handled by Shochiku.

Voice Cast

To bring this deep drama and mystery to life, the project gathered a select group of seiyuus and actors from the industry:

  • Hiiro Ishibashi as Kazuki Tsukigase.Recognized for lending his voice to the character Umi in the acclaimed film Kaijuu no Kodomo (Children of the Sea).
  • Anna Nagase as Nao Akishika.World-renowned for her roles as Ushio Kofune in Summer Time Rendering and Riko Amanai in Jujutsu Kaisen.
  • Simba Tsuchiya as Mikiya Ozaki.Famous for playing Tsutomu Goshiki in the sports hit Haikyuu!! and Tatara Fujita in Welcome to the Ballroom.
  • Hiroshi Tamaki as Kozu.Experienced film and television actor who portrayed Tatsu in the live-action version of Gokushufudou.

The secret of the girl who came from the year 1974

The original novel was conceived by author Akiko Abe, recently achieving a manga adaptation under the Shueisha publishing label. The premise follows Kazuki Tsukigase, a boy who decides to transfer to a high school on a secluded island with the sole purpose of moving away from his past and anyone who knows him. His self-imposed exile changes radically when he explores a particular inlet that locals associate with mysterious disappearances.

In this remote place, Kazuki finds the unconscious body of a young girl. Upon waking, she shows a severe case of temporal amnesia; the only thing she can articulate is that her name is Nao, she is 16 years old, and she repeatedly whispers the year "1974". This chance encounter triggers a race against time to discover her identity before the temporal anomalies take their toll.
